Of COURSE their songs are used in folk circles. Why not?
The main limiting factor is that a number of them are rather hard to sing without a piano. They take something from patter and music hall songs, so you have to be able to deliver words and tune clearly and quickly.
And it's sometimes hard to grasp the multiple key changes without adequate accompaniment.
I suspect a number of people who don't know that Tom Lehrer wrote "The Irish Ballad" (commonly called Rickety Tickety Tin), sing it at folk gatherings.
Ditto the "Hippopotamus Song".
